The Detroit Tigers defeated the Oakland Athletics 8-6 on Saturday night, taking the second game of their three-game series. The Tigers are now seeking a road sweep of the Athletics on Sunday.

The Tigers secured the win thanks in part to Max Clark hitting his first major league home run and a quality start from Framber Valdez. Despite these positive contributions, the Tigers’ bullpen faced challenges in the late innings, nearly relinquishing their lead.

The series began with Detroit aiming to capitalize on Oakland's struggles this season. Saturday night’s victory puts them in position to complete a sweep, demonstrating their ability to perform well on the road against a struggling opponent. The final game of the series is scheduled for Sunday, where the Tigers will attempt to finish strong and secure all three games.
